So, what exactly is Delta 11? Think of it as a rare cannabinoid that’s finally getting the attention it deserves. For years, it was a background player in the cannabis plant, but now it’s stepping into the spotlight for consumers seeking a fresh experience.

Delta 11, or Delta-11-Tetrahydrocannabinol (Δ11-THC), is a minor cannabinoid found naturally in hemp and cannabis. Its recent rise in popularity isn't because it's new to science, but because it's finally accessible on the market. That’s a key distinction when comparing it to its famous relatives, Delta 9 and Delta 8.
The buzz is happening now for two main reasons: legal shifts and scientific progress. The 2018 Farm Bill cracked open the door for hemp-derived products, creating a federal framework for cannabinoids as long as they contain less than 0.3% Delta 9 THC. This move sparked a massive wave of interest in exploring the other compounds hidden in the hemp plant.
While Delta 11 might feel like a new discovery, it’s been on the scientific radar for decades. Researchers first mentioned it in studies way back in the 1970s, but it was largely ignored. With natural levels often below 0.1%, it simply wasn't practical to extract for commercial products until modern lab techniques made it possible.

If Delta-11 is so rare in nature, how does it end up in vapes and edibles? The answer isn't extraction—it's transformation. Chemists have found a way to convert more common cannabinoids into Delta-11, making this once-obscure compound widely available.
The starting material is usually Cannabidiol (CBD), the non-psychoactive compound found abundantly in legal hemp. Since directly extracting Delta-11 isn't practical, scientists use a process called isomerization to rearrange the molecular structure of CBD and turn it into something new.
Think of it like this: a chemist starts with a CBD molecule, which is like a specific shape made of Lego bricks. Using a controlled process, they carefully take that structure apart and reassemble the exact same bricks into a new shape—the Delta-11 molecule. Nothing new is added; the original pieces are just put together in a different order.
This molecular shuffle is what matters. By changing the location of a single chemical bond, the compound's properties are completely altered, turning non-intoxicating CBD into the unique Delta-11 cannabinoid.
The most common method for this is acid-catalyzed isomerization. While it sounds technical, the idea is simple. Scientists use an acid as a catalyst, which triggers the CBD molecules to rearrange themselves into the Delta-11 structure.
This technique is a huge leap forward for cannabinoid science. As explained in a breakdown of hemp-derived innovation from 3CHI, modern lab methods have become incredibly efficient since the 2018 Farm Bill passed. Today, labs can produce Delta-11 isolate with purities between 90-99%, driving down costs and making it accessible to everyone.

Finally, let’s compare Delta 11 to THCA (Tetrahydrocannabinolic acid). This comparison is a bit different because THCA is a non-psychoactive cannabinoid in its raw, unheated form. It only converts into psychoactive Delta 9 THC when you apply heat through smoking, vaping, or cooking.
Delta 11, on the other hand, is psychoactive right out of the gate—no heat necessary. When you take a Delta 11 edible or tincture, it’s already in an active state that your body can use to produce effects. This makes it a completely different compound from THCA, which is essentially a precursor waiting to be transformed. When it comes to new cannabinoids, the biggest question is always about legality. So, let's get straight to it. The rules for Delta 11 are a patchwork of federal permissions and state-level restrictions, making it crucial to know what’s what before you buy.
On a federal level, it all starts with the 2018 Farm Bill. This landmark legislation made hemp and its derivatives federally legal, as long as they contain less than 0.3% Delta 9 THC by dry weight. Since the Delta 11 you see in products is made from legal, hemp-derived CBD, it technically falls under this federal green light.
But federal compliance is only half the story. Things get complicated because of the Federal Analogue Act and, more importantly, individual state laws. While the Analogue Act could theoretically be used against THC isomers, it hasn't been a major issue for hemp-derived cannabinoids so far.
The more immediate concern is what your state says. Even if Delta 11 is federally compliant, many states have passed their own laws banning or restricting synthesized THC isomers. That means a product can be perfectly legal in one state but completely illegal just across the border.

Yes, you should assume it absolutely will. Standard drug tests are built to find THC metabolites in your system, but they aren't smart enough to tell the difference between Delta-9, Delta-8, or Delta-11.
To put it simply, your body breaks them all down in a similar way. If you’re subject to any kind of drug testing, the safest bet is to steer clear of all THC products, including Delta-11.
It's a little of both, which can be confusing. Delta-11 is a cannabinoid that occurs naturally in hemp and cannabis, but only in trace amounts—far too little to extract for commercial use. It's not a compound created from scratch using harsh, artificial chemicals.
The Delta-11 you'll find in vapes and edibles is best described as semi-synthetic. It starts as a natural, plant-derived compound like CBD and is then converted into Delta-11 in a lab through a safe process called isomerization.
This method is what allows brands to create a pure, consistent, and potent Delta-11 experience that would be impossible to get straight from the plant.
